Lab-grown diamonds vs mined diamonds

As of 2018, the Federal Trade Commission (FTC) considers both lab-grown and mined diamonds to be real. Unlike a mined diamond, a lab-grown diamond such as a VRAI created diamond has guaranteed origin.

The naked eye cannot tell the difference between a lab-grown and mined diamond. Most trained gemologists cannot tell the difference between a polished mined diamond and a polished lab-grown diamond without using advanced technology.

How lab grown diamonds are created

Lab-grown diamonds are produced by two methods: chemical vapor deposition (CVD) or high pressure, high temperature (HPHT).

HPHT is the less energy efficient method and involves placing a diamond seed into pure carbon, then exposing it to intense pressure and heat. The carbon attaches to the diamond seed and forms a rough diamond with a complex cuboctahedron shape.

CVD is a more sustainable process, using vacuum chambers to convert carbon-heavy gasses into plasma with less energy consumption. Kinetics allow the carbon atoms inside the chamber to build on top of the diamond seed in a single vertical direction so the rough diamond grows into a cleaner square shape.

The VRAI created diamonds are lab-grown diamonds created using the CVD method.

A thin sliver of diamond is placed within a plasma reactor. The process then begins when carbon is atomized within the reactor.  The carbon atoms stack on top of the slice until it grows into a pure, jewelry-grade diamond of gem size.

Lab-grown diamond vs mined diamond

Lab-grown and mined diamonds are nearly impossible to tell apart. Both are identical in appearance and chemical composition. Their few subtle differences come from their growth process and are not a reflection of their quality.

The main difference between mined and lab-grown diamonds is their morphology — their natural shape before cutting and polishing.

Mined diamonds grow as an octahedron. HPHT diamonds grow as a cuboctahedron, while CVD diamonds such as VRAI created diamonds grow as a cube.

Both mined and lab-grown diamonds have inclusions, which occur naturally during the growth process. Both origins occasionally produce flawless diamonds, which are rare and very valuable. Both mined and man-made diamonds must be graded for their clarity on a scale from Flawless to Included.

Lab-grown and mined diamonds “sparkle” in the same way — because they are both real diamonds.

A diamond’s brilliance comes from its ability to bend or refract light.

Light enters a diamond and is then reflected off its interior surfaces, called facets. This light interacting with the diamond’s multiple surfaces is its brilliance.

Brilliance depends on a diamond’s cut. A poorly-cut diamond will not shine as brightly as one with a high-quality cut. 

Rainbow or colored light is referred to as a diamond’s “fire.” A diamond’s fire should only appear on a diamond’s outer surfaces, however, whether man-made or mined. If you look closely at a stone and rainbow colors appear within, it is likely synthetic. Moissanite and cubic zirconia are known for reflecting back lots of rainbow-colored light.

The 4Cs of diamonds are cut, color, clarity, and carat weight. The 4Cs are considered the international standard to measure a diamond’s quality and establish its value. Each C has a specific way of being measured and graded. Their quality is recorded in a diamond grading report.

Diamond cut is not the shape of the diamond. Diamond cut refers to how the diamond is specifically cut and polished and determines how light enters and exits the diamond.

Diamond color refers to the absence of color in a diamond. Diamonds are considered more rare and valuable the closer to "colorless" they are. Diamond color is graded on a scale from D (colorless) to Z (very noticeable yellow color). Most engagement rings and diamond jewelry sits in the D-J range of colorless to near colorless. It's important to note that this scale is different than fancy color diamonds like pink, blue or green diamonds.

Diamond clarity refers to the visual purity of a diamond. This relates to how many inclusions or imperfections are present in a diamond. The diamonds with the highest clarity have the fewest inclusions.

Diamond carat refers to the size of a diamond which is traditionally measured by carat size.
